A newly created table will have no data. + - New functions `octet_length` and `length` were introduced. Previously, users would either have to read + the data and check the length themselves or enable UDF and register UDFs to check the length of columns. + CASSANDRA-20102 adds a subset of the SQL99 (binary) string functions: "octet_length" defined on all types + and "length" defined on UTF8 strings. See CASSANDRA-20102 for more information. For example, `bigint_as_blob(3)` returns `0x0000000000000003` and `blob_as_bigint(0x0000000000000003)` returns `3`. +==== Length Functions +CQL supports two functions to retrieve the length of data without returning the data itself. Note that while +network bandwidth is reduced and memory is freed earlier, these functions still require data to be read from disk. + +[cols=",,",options="header",] +|=== +|Function name |Input type |Description + +| `octet_length` | All xref:cassandra:developing/cql/types.adoc#native-types[types] | Returns the length of the data in bytes. + +| `length` | `text` | Returns the string's length - the count of UTF-8 code units. +|=== + +The `octet_length` function is defined for every xref:cassandra:developing/cql/types.adoc#native-types[type] +supported by CQL, and represents the number of bytes of the underlying `ByteBuffer` representation, not accounting for +metadata overhead. Equivalent to Java's +https://docs.oracle.com/en/java/javase/22/docs/api/java.base/java/nio/Buffer.html#remaining()[`ByteBuffer#remaining()`] +when data has just been read, which is also the `length` of the type when encoded to `byte[]`. Some examples +for common types: + +[cols=",,",options="header",] +|=== +|CQL Type | `octet_length` |Description + +| `tinyint` | `1` | 8-bit signed integer + +| `smallint` | `2` | 16-bit signed integer + +| `int` | `4` | 32-bit signed integer + +| `bigint` | `8` | 64-bit signed integer + +| `float` | `4` | 32-bit IEEE-754 floating point + +| `double` | `8` | 64-bit IEEE-754 floating point + +| `blob` | Number of bytes in blob | Variable length byte string + +| `text` | Number of bytes in `text_as_blob` representation | Variable length character string +|=== + +The `length` function is only defined for UTF-8 strings (`text`) and returns the length of that string, meaning the +number of UTF-8 code units. Equivalent to Java's +https://docs.oracle.com/en/java/javase/22/docs/api/java.base/java/lang/String.html#length()[`String#length()`] or +Python 3's `len` function when applied to a string. + +These length functions return `null` when the input is `null`. + ==== Math Functions Cql provides the following math functions: `abs`, `exp`, `log`, `log10`, and `round`. diff --git a/src/java/org/apache/cassandra/cql3/functions/LengthFcts.java b/src/java/org/apache/cassandra/cql3/functions/LengthFcts.java new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..64cb940606 --- /dev/null +++ b/src/java/org/apache/cassandra/cql3/functions/LengthFcts.java @@ -0,0 +1,93 @@ +/* + * Licensed to the Apache Software Foundation (ASF) under one + * or more contributor license agreements.
